What to check before for buildings near the South Brooklyn route in NYC

  • Filter and compare buildings by what’s available right now, then open each building page to review renter Q&A and rating signals.
  • Confirm commute details in person: ferry schedules, walking time to the dock, and whether you’ll be depending on other transit on non-ferry days.
  • Watch fees and move-in costs beyond the asking rent (application fees, security deposit, broker fees, and utility responsibilities).
  • If a building mentions amenities or transit convenience, verify any rules (package handling, bike storage, elevator wait times, and access requirements).
  • Check lease basics early: lease length options, renewal terms, and any documented restrictions (pets, smoking, and utilities).
